What is an ICT policy?
An ICT (Information and Communications Technology) Security Policy is a document that outlines the rules, guidelines and procedures for protecting an organisation's ICT systems and infrastructure from security threats and vulnerabilities.

What is the ICT acceptable use policy?
The purpose of this policy is to ensure that users understand the ways in which the ICT equipment, software and wi-fi is to be used. The policy aims to ensure that ICT facilities and the internet are used effectively for their intended purpose, without infringing legal requirements or creating unnecessary risk.

What does ICT mean?
Information and communication technology, abbreviated as ICT, covers all technical means used to handle information and aid communication. This includes both computer and network hardware, as well as their software.
What is an example of an IT policy?
Some common policies include data security, password management, incident response, disaster recovery, change management, BYOD, asset management etc. Regular policy reviews help your organization stay in line with technological and regulatory changes.
